SCENE SAFETY
Ensure the scene is safe prior to exiting the
apparatus (watch for traffic).
Secure the scene prior to beginning
extrication/ rescue operations.
○ Place your vehicle on scene to protect the
rescuers and victims from traffic.
○ Ensure there aren’t any other safety issues
that need to be secured first.
i.e. -Down Power Lines
○ Notify any additional resources.
i.e. : ALS, Security / PD etc.

PROPER USAGE
1. Do Not Kink Hoses
2. Do Not pull the hoses to
move the tools.
3. Prevent twisting of the hose
4. Do Not use hoses to keep
equipment in position.
(especially if hoses are
pressurized)

Maintenance
• Avoid allowing dirt inside of
the couplings.
•Remove dirt and oil with a
clean dry rag.
•Clean with mild soap and
water.
• You may Lubricate the
coupling with hydraulic oil or
by spraying WD-40.
•Spray behind the locking
sleeve and the back end of
the coupling. (Location A)
A
NOTE: After removing dust caps from the hydraulic hoses, make sure to
secure the dust caps on the power unit by fastening them together around
the frame. This keeps the dust caps from getting dirty and getting lost.

PORTABLE POWER
UNIT OPERATIONS1. Ensure Proper PPE’s are worn during operation.
2. Connect proper tool for rescue operations to the hydraulic hose found on the shelf above the hydraulic tools.
3. Check fuel level, oil level, and hydraulic fluid levels, and ensure connections are secure.
4. Ensure the Engine ON/OFF switch is in the On position.
5. Ensure your fuel ON/OFF switch is in the On position.
6. COLD START- ensure choke is in the On position and speed switch is on the fast position.
7. Pull starting chord to start the engine.
8. Once engine starts, turn off choke switch, and adjust engine speed.
9. You are now ready to operate your Holmatro Tool.
10. Turn the Operating Relief Valve to the Operation position.
